Is Your Google Business Profile a Work of Art?

This is non-negotiable.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is your digital storefront on Google Maps and local search results. Is it fully optimised? Are your business hours accurate (especially crucial during Canberra’s seasonal events)? Have you uploaded high-quality, Instagrammable photos of your products or services? Are you actively encouraging and responding to reviews? A well-maintained GBP is like having a prime spot in Civic – impossible to miss!

What Local Keywords Are Your Customers Actually Typing?

This is more than just ‘Canberra florist’. Think more specific. Are people searching for ‘native flower arrangements Canberra’, ‘wedding florist Barton’, or ‘same-day flower delivery Gungahlin’? Brainstorm terms that your ideal customer would use. Tools can help, but your intuition about your business and its location is gold. We want to capture those hyper-local searches that indicate high intent.

Are Your Website and NAP Consistent Across the Web?

NAP stands for Name, Address, Phone number. This triad MUST be identical everywhere your business is listed online – your website, social media, directories, and especially your GBP. Inconsistencies confuse search engines and can tank your local SEO rankings. Imagine a visitor trying to find your charming cafe in Lyneham, only to find different addresses online – frustrating, right?
